Default AMD's Zen 5 chips set to sizzle

According to Toms’ Hardware MSI's just has brought in initial support for what’s most likely to be Ryzen 9000 CPUs. MSI's latest firmware for its AM5 chipset motherboards is flaunting AGESA 1.1.7.0, and it's whispering sweet nothings about AMD's "next-gen CPU."
